Recognizing the sorts of nursing home abuse is vital for addressing the persecution and identifying of susceptible locals. Assisted living home abuse can show up in various types, each positioning significant risks to the health of elderly individuals. Physical abuse involves making use of force that results in bodily harm, while psychological misuse includes verbal attacks, dangers, and intimidation focused on diminishing a citizen's self-worth.Overlook, an additional prevalent form, takes place when caretakers stop working to supply essential care, bring about damage in health and wellness and quality of life. Financial exploitation entails the unauthorized usage of a local's funds or building, typically leaving them in precarious economic situations.
Sexual assault is an important concern, including any non-consensual sexual call. Recognizing these types allows family members and supporters to better recognize and react to the various kinds of mistreatment that can take place within assisted living facility settings, making certain that citizens receive the care and respect they deserve.

Physical signs of abuse can materialize in numerous kinds, usually offering as crucial proof in retirement home abuse insurance claims. Usual signs include unexplained injuries such as burns, bruises, or fractures, which might recommend physical mistreatment. Malnutrition and dehydration can additionally show disregard, shown by significant weight management or bad hygiene. Additionally, the presence of untreated medical conditions may aim to inadequate care. Locals may show signs of being restrained, such as marks on wrists or ankle joints. It is necessary to record these physical indications meticulously, as they can substantiate cases of abuse or disregard. Nursing home misuse cases can vary substantially by territory, they are largely governed by a mix of government and state regulations developed to shield the rights of vulnerable residents. The Federal Nursing Home Reform Act establishes Nursing Home Abuse minimal treatment criteria, mandating that facilities offer residents with a safe atmosphere and adequate care. Additionally, state regulations may impose more stringent guidelines, covering facets such as staffing proportions and coverage requirements. Lawful treatments frequently include injury cases, elder abuse laws, and oversight claims. The Americans with Disabilities Act guarantees that individuals with handicaps get ideal care without discrimination. The legal process surrounding assisted living facility abuse asserts entails numerous crucial actions that attorneys have to navigate to successfully promote for their customers. Originally, legal representatives must perform a thorough investigation, collecting evidence such as clinical documents, photos, and witness statements to corroborate insurance claims. Once enough proof is compiled, attorneys commonly file a problem in the ideal court, detailing the claims versus the assisted living facility and looking for problems. Following this, the discovery phase starts, permitting both parties to trade details. If the instance does not clear up via arrangement, it might proceed to trial, where attorneys provide their arguments before a judge or jury. Just how Lengthy Do I Have to File a Nursing Home Misuse Insurance Claim?
Commonly, people have one to 3 years to file a nursing home abuse case, depending upon state laws. It's vital to talk to a lawyer to assure compliance with certain target dates and demands.Can Family Members File Claims on Part of the Victim?
Member of the family can submit insurance claims on part of assisted living home abuse sufferers, specifically if the target is disarmed or not able to advocate on their own. Legal representation is commonly suggested to browse the intricacies of such cases.What Are the Possible End Results of a Retirement Home Misuse Suit?
Prospective end results of a retirement home abuse legal action consist of financial payment for problems, adjustments in facility techniques, enhanced oversight, and potentially criminal costs versus wrongdoers, all focused on making certain victim justice and avoiding future abuse.Just how much Does It Expense to Employ a Legal Representative for These Instances?
Hiring a legal representative for nursing home abuse instances usually entails contingency charges, ranging from 25% to 40% of the negotiation. Added prices may consist of court costs and professional witness expenses, varying based upon the instance intricacy.Suppose the Assisted Living Facility Refutes the Accusations of Misuse?
